<noframes id="ndrzl"><form id="ndrzl"><nobr id="ndrzl"></nobr></form>

<sub id="ndrzl"><listing id="ndrzl"><listing id="ndrzl"></listing></listing></sub><noframes id="ndrzl">

<address id="ndrzl"><nobr id="ndrzl"><progress id="ndrzl"></progress></nobr></address>
<address id="ndrzl"><form id="ndrzl"></form></address>

<listing id="ndrzl"></listing>

<noframes id="ndrzl">

    <address id="ndrzl"></address>
    Spring Security視頻教程
    視頻介紹

    Spring Security實戰精講-細說Spring Security安全框架

    課程資料 視頻教程 配套源碼 學習筆記 學習工具 免費下載 學習文檔
    • 中級
    • 73全集
    • 145066次學習

    課程簡介

    課程下載

    相關文章

    課程簡介

    Spring Security是一個基于Spring的安全框架,提供了一套Web應用安全性的完整解決方案。一般來說,Web應用的安全性包括用戶認證(Authentication)和用戶授權(Authorization)兩個部分。

    用戶認證指的是驗證某個用戶是否為系統中的合法主體,也就是說用戶能否訪問該系統。用戶認證一般要求用戶提供用戶名和密碼,系統通過校驗用戶名和密碼來完成認證過程。

    用戶授權指的是驗證某個用戶是否有權限執行某個操作。在一個系統中,不同用戶所具有的權限是不同的。一般來說,系統會為不同的用戶分配不同的角色,而每個角色則對應一系列的權限。

    本課程細說Spring Security這套安全框架,通過案例帶你快速學習掌握Spring Security。

    前提條件:學習過Spring及SpringBoot的人群。

    環境參數:Idea , JDK8,maven 3+,spring boot 2.0.6,spring security 5.0.9

    課程目錄

    ?001.security-框架介紹 ?002.security-初探-1 ?003.security-初探-2 ?004.security-初探-3 ?005.security-初探-4 ?006.security-自定義用戶名和密碼 ?007.security-關閉驗證功能 ?008.security-基于內存的用戶信息-思路 ?009.security-基于內存的用戶信息-定義用戶 ?010.security-基于內存的用戶信息-密碼加密 ?011.security-基于內存用戶信息的角色設置 ?012.security-基于內存用戶信息的方法設置角色訪問權限 ?013.security-基于內存用戶信息的方法設置角色測試 ?014.security-基于內存用戶信息的方法設置角色測步驟總結 ?015.security-jdbc用戶信息主要接口 ?016.security-jdbc用戶信息maven依賴 ?017.security-jdbc用戶信息創建dao和service ?018.security-jdbc用戶信息測試數據訪問 ?019.security-jdbc用戶信息初始化用戶表數據 ?020.security-jdbc用戶信息實現UserDetailsService接口 ?021.security-jdbc用戶信息測試角色和用戶 ?022.角色-RBAC ?023.角色-RBAC數據庫表介紹 ?024.認證類UserDetailsService ?025.InMemoryUserDetatilsService的創建 ?026.測試InMemoryUserDetailsService賬號 ?027.創建表 ?028.創建Modules ?029.創建JdbcUserDetailsManager對象 ?030.測試JdbcUserDetailsManager-1 ?031.測試JdbcUserDetatilsManager-2 ?032.設計用戶角色表 ?033.創建Modules-自定義用戶和角色 ?034.security-表結構介紹 ?035.security-自定義UserDetails實現類SysUser ?036.security-創建SysUserMapper文件 ?037.security-添加mybatis框架配置數據 ?038.security-通過程序初始SysUser賬號數據 ?039.security-手工初始角色數據 ?040.security-創建SysUser查詢方法 ?041.security-創建SysRoleMapper接口和mapper文件 ?042.security-查詢角色信息 ?043.security-實現UserDetailsService接口 ?044.security-讓框架使用自定義的UserDetailsService實現 ?045.security-創建測試的html和Controller ?046.security-設置url權限定義 ?047.security-設置url角色 ?048.security-賬號過期的解決 ?049.security-設置密碼處理方式 ?050.security-功能實現步驟 ?051.security-默認登錄頁面 ?052.security-自定義登錄頁面 ?053.security-使用自定義mylogin頁面 ?054.security-設置自定義登錄配置參數 ?055.security-自定義登錄總結 ?056.security-ajax登錄頁面 ?057.security-創建SuccessHandler ?058.security-創建FailureHandler ?059.security-指定配置Handler ?060.security-使用jackson處理json ?061.security-文檔總結 ?062.security-介紹本節內容 ?063.security-創建生成驗證的Controller定義參數 ?064.security-繪制白色的背景圖片 ?065.security-向圖片寫入多個文字 ?066.security-設置干擾線 ?067.security-驗證生成文檔 ?068.security-ajax請求增加code參數 ?069.security-過濾器介紹 ?070.security-創建過濾器-1 ?071.security-創建過濾器-2 ?072.security-添加自定義過濾器 ?073.security-總結
    課程資料 視頻教程 配套源碼 學習筆記 學習工具 免費下載 學習文檔
    下載方法
    獲取本套教程

    ①掃描右側二維碼關注公眾號

    ②回復消息【Spring Security】

    ③獲取本套課程免費下載鏈接

    獲取全套教程

    ①掃描右側二維碼關注公眾號

    ②回復消息【DLJD】

    ③獲取全套課程免費下載鏈接

    掃碼關注公眾號

    告訴你包裝類的作用有哪些

    1.基本數據類型:整型:intshortbytelong浮點型:floatdouble字符:char布爾:boolean2.包裝類型Integer、Long、S...

    2022-11-25 10:27:05

    二維數組初始化的方法

    在Java中初始化二維數組的不同方法:data_type[][]array_Name=newdata_type[no_of_rows][no_of_column...

    2022-11-25 10:04:59

    Shell腳本語法的規則

    變量1.變量的定義和使用shell腳本中定義變量名不加$符,中間不能有空格和標點符號,可以有下劃線,不能有shell關鍵字(關鍵字可以使用help查看)使用一個...

    2022-11-25 09:44:21

    線性表是什么

    線性表,全名為線性存儲結構。使用線性表存儲數據的方式可以這樣理解,即&ldquo;把所有數據用一根線兒串起來,再存儲到物理空間中&rdquo;。如圖1所示,這是...

    2022-11-24 11:45:44

    關于rest參數使用的例子

    ES6引入了rest參數用于獲取函數的多余參數,實際就是替換arguments對象。1.舉一個小例子:functionadd(...values){letsum...

    2022-11-24 10:30:03

    關于持久化存儲的介紹

    持久存儲和容器由于在開發、構建和部署應用程序時迅速采用Docker容器,最近出現了存儲持久性意識。盡管最初假設是無狀態的,但很明顯存在有價值的用例(例如數據庫)...

    2022-11-24 09:45:31

    負載均衡的原理介紹

    負載均衡的原理是什么?動力節點小編來為大家進行介紹。1.http重定向當http代理(比如瀏覽器)向web服務器請求某個URL后,web服務器可以通過http響...

    2022-11-23 08:31:35

    代理模式的應用場景

    代理模式的應用場景有哪些?動力節點小編來告訴大家。1.日志的采集2.權限控制3.實現aop4.Mybatismapper5.Spring事務管理6.全局捕獲異常...

    2022-11-23 08:10:15

    數據庫連接池的工作原理

    數據庫連接池的基本思想就是為數據庫連接建立一個&ldquo;緩沖池&rdquo;,預先在緩沖池中放入一定數量的連接,當需要建立數據庫連接時,只需從&ldquo;...

    2022-11-23 07:50:21

    堆棧溢出的原因

    堆棧溢出的原因有哪些?動力節點小編來告訴大家。堆溢出當創建對象時,沒有足夠的可用空間,則會發生堆溢出。堆內存空間不足,一種是真的不夠,還有一種是發生了死循環,對...

    2022-11-23 07:35:39

    技術文檔

    >全部

    熱門課程

    >學習路線
    返回頂部
    av无码天堂热久久
    <noframes id="ndrzl"><form id="ndrzl"><nobr id="ndrzl"></nobr></form>

    <sub id="ndrzl"><listing id="ndrzl"><listing id="ndrzl"></listing></listing></sub><noframes id="ndrzl">

    <address id="ndrzl"><nobr id="ndrzl"><progress id="ndrzl"></progress></nobr></address>
    <address id="ndrzl"><form id="ndrzl"></form></address>

    <listing id="ndrzl"></listing>

    <noframes id="ndrzl">

      <address id="ndrzl"></address>